So here's a story I wrote about the reasons for the formation changes a couple of weeks ago, I think it's still holding up.

 

So you're Darren Moore.

 

You start the season with half the team fit, but end up at the top after 4 games, due to your defence.

You have a formation, the new fangled 4231 that everyone's playing now, it's all good.

Your new striker is on 2 goals in 3 games, everything's great.

Then Morecambe. They pack the box. We throw everything at them and lose. Just a blip. No bother. Striker on 2 in 4. Still good.

Plymouth. Boom. Get destroyed. Concede 3, New striker doesn't even get a shot all game. 2 in 5.

Now the whispers start. Lowe would be much better in Sheffield, he's one of us, after all.

Shrewsbury. We start well. Goal from a corner. Bannan pen. Miss. They equalise and it finishes 1-1. Striker, 3 shots, no goal. 2 in 6.

The whispers get louder. It's Shrewsbury! We're the mighty Sheffield Wednesday, we won the cup 30 years ago!

Then Ipswich, 1-1 again. Striker has 1 shot off target. 2 in 7.

The whispers are shouts. We need to change the formation. Our striker can't play this formation. He needs a friend. When he get's service, he's the best in this league. Moore Out!

OK, says Darren, I should really drop him, but he is our top scorer.

Wigan. We play Pato up in the 10 spot. We score 2. Win. Striker has 3 shots! That's 3 times more than he usually gets, and an assist! Told you if he had a friend he'd be good. 2 in 8. He's got to score soon.

Then comes Oxford. 1-2. Back to 4231. Striker goes off at half time, no shots.

Shouts getting louder. 4231 doesn't work. If striker has a friend, we'll score 2, just like Wigan! He's the best striker in the league! Moore Out!

Right then, says Darren. We aren't going to score many, look at the last few games. Let's sort out the back and pack defence. I can't drop our top scorer, can I? Let's give him 2 friends. That should do it. The wingers haven't scored 2 like he has, have they?

Bolton. He's scored! We win. Told you Darren, if you setup our whole team to get the ball to him and give him friends, he'll score. Never mind changing our entire team to revolve around him, we won. Moore In!

Happy days, says Darren. Let's make up some guff about playing to the opposition, and not mention that I was too scared to drop my top scorer, even though he doesn't fit the team or tactics. 

 

This is an excerpt from my upcoming book "How Gregory tanked Wednesday's promotion chances and was loved for it" available in no good bookshops.
